How does an anonymous proxy server hide an IP address?
An anonymous proxy server hides an IP address by making requests
for data on another computer's behalf. If you are browsing the web
through an anonymous proxy server, your computer tells the proxy
server what website you want to view. The proxy then connects to
the website for you. The website uses the IP adddress of the proxy
server to send back the requested data. The proxy server then sends
the data you requested (the website) back to you. Not all proxy
servers are anonymous. Also, for the anonymous proxy server to work
as intended, it needs to be configured properly.
